How much does it cost to rent an apartment in St. Anthony?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| St. Anthony Studio Apartments | $1,417 | $745 | $2,319 |
| St. Anthony 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,699 | $691 | $8,259 |
| St. Anthony 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,219 | $469 | $8,971 |
| St. Anthony 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,275 | $495 | $9,831 |
| St. Anthony 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,679 | $535 | $3,594 |
| St. Anthony 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,184 | $2,800 | $3,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about St. Anthony Apartments with Laundry Rooms
What is the Cheapest Laundry Rooms apartment in St. Anthony?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in St. Anthony with Laundry Rooms is at Yugo The Sydney at Dinkytown listed at $469.
How much is the average rent for St. Anthony Apartments with Laundry Rooms?
The average rent for a Apartment in St. Anthony with Laundry Rooms is $1,728.
What is the largest St. Anthony Apartment for rent with Laundry Rooms?
Today's Apartment with Laundry Rooms and the most square footage in St. Anthony is a 2,791 square feet unit starting from $1,520 at NIC on 5th.
What is the average size for St. Anthony Apartments for rent with Laundry Rooms?
The average size for a rental with Laundry Rooms in St. Anthony is currently at 609 sq ft.
